The Jiayang Steam Train is running 20 km west of Qianwei County in the south of Sichuan province. The Shixi - Huangcunjing Railway (also named Bashi Railway), a narrow gauge railway, 19.8 km long and only 762 mm wide, was built in 1958. There are 6 tunnels (905 meters in total) and 109 arcs on the railway. The maximum slope is 36‰. It is the only passenger steam train that still runs in China and even in the world, reputed as the "living fossil of the Industrial Revolution" and vividly rated as “Primitive Living Landscape of Industrial Revolution”.
